International Standard Version
All who serve carved images and those who praise idols will be humiliated. Worship him, all you "gods"!
A Conservative Version
Let all those be put to shame who serve graven images, who boast themselves of idols. Bow yourselves to him, all ye gods.
American Standard Version
Let all them be put to shame that serve graven images, That boast themselves of idols: Worship him, all ye gods.

Bible in Basic English
Shamed be all those who give worship to images, and take pride in false gods; give him worship, all you gods.
Darby Translation
Ashamed be all they that serve graven images, that boast themselves of idols. Worship him, all ye gods.
Julia Smith Translation
All serving a carved thing shall be ashamed, they boasting themselves in nothings; worship to him, all ye Gods.
King James 2000
Confounded be all they that serve graven images, that boast themselves of idols: worship him, all you gods.
Lexham Expanded Bible
Let all who serve an image be ashamed, those who boast about idols. Worship him, all you gods.
Modern King James verseion
All those who serve graven images are ashamed, those who boast themselves in idols; all gods bow down before Him.
NET Bible
All who worship idols are ashamed, those who boast about worthless idols. All the gods bow down before him.
New Heart English Bible
Let all them be shamed who serve engraved images, who boast in their idols. Worship him, all you gods.
The Emphasized Bible
Let all who serve an image, be ashamed, They who boast themselves in things of nought, Bow down unto him, all ye gods.
Webster
Confounded be all they that serve graven images, that boast themselves of idols; worship him, all ye gods.
World English Bible
Let all them be shamed who serve engraved images, who boast in their idols. Worship him, all you gods!
Youngs Literal Translation
Ashamed are all servants of a graven image, Those boasting themselves in idols, Bow yourselves to him, all ye gods.
